A bar and restaurant, formerly open to non residents, in a small family run hotel. Built in the 1880s as a private hunting lodge, for Laird Macintosh of Macintosh, the branch was advised in Summer 2017 of an Isle of Skye hand pump! Be sure to ask after "Oscar" the resident macaw. Please note, only open between 1 March and 31 October, and "dummy" times" until visited.
